""Safe Deposit Box Number 4016"" is a novel written by Frank West Rollins and published in 1913. The story follows the life of a young man named Richard Hallowell, who inherits a safe deposit box from his late father. Inside the box, Richard finds a mysterious letter that leads him on a journey to uncover the truth about his family's past.As Richard delves deeper into his family's history, he discovers dark secrets and hidden treasures that ultimately lead him to a life-changing decision. Along the way, he meets a cast of intriguing characters, including a beautiful and enigmatic woman named Mary Sinclair.The novel is a thrilling adventure that takes readers on a journey through the world of high finance, international intrigue, and family drama.
